Deputy Minister of Defence Aruna Jayasekara chaired a special discussion at the Parliament Complex to accelerate welfare assistance for Tri-Forces personnel, Police officers, and members of the Special Task Force (STF) who sustained disabilities as a result of terrorist activities during Sri Lanka’s conflict.

The meeting focused on the rapid implementation of a government-backed welfare programme aimed at addressing long-standing issues faced by disabled members of the security forces. The initiative follows Cabinet approval of recommendations submitted by a committee appointed to identify affected personnel and provide suitable relief measures.

Discussions also centered on establishing medical boards under the Ministry of Health to assess cases involving military and police personnel who were killed, disabled, or discharged from service due to conflict-related injuries.

Officials explored plans to decentralize medical board services and expand their operations to regional areas, making it easier for disabled veterans across the country to access assessments and benefits.

Deputy Minister Jayasekara instructed relevant authorities to expedite the implementation of the programme and ensure that welfare assistance reaches eligible beneficiaries without delay.

He further emphasized the importance of utilizing medical facilities within the Tri-Forces to support referrals and speed up the processing of welfare claims, reaffirming the government’s commitment to supporting those who sacrificed in service to the nation.

The meeting was attended by the Tri-Forces Commanders, the Director General of Health Services, senior Ministry of Defence officials, and representatives from the Tri-Forces, Sri Lanka Police, and the Special Task Force.
